Art is not a luxury! Art arises from one's depths or it is not art but kitsch! Art, for me, is and was my digging tool for Meaning, for Truth. . . my own truth that may speak to your truth. Art then becomes a religious, a spiritual act, not in any sectarian sense but as a witness to a religious attitude to sheer being, to existence as such, being Supremely Meaningful.
- Frederick Franck, from the booklet Pacem In Terris.
